Abstract
Malnutrition is a common complication observed in hospitalized patients with inflammatory bowel disease (IBD). Enteral nutrition therapy can be used to support the nutritional needs of inpatients with IBD. However, evidence on the impact of inpatient enteral nutrition on clinical outcomes is equivocal. This study assesses post-hospitalization outcomes associated with enteral nutrition therapy amongst inpatients with IBD in a large nationwide database.
